<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html;
charset=ISO-8859-1">
<meta name="Generator" content="Microsoft Word 12 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Candara;
        panose-1:2 14 5 2 3 3 3 2 2 4;}
@font-face
        {font-family:GTZ-Logo;
        panose-1:0 0 0 0 0 0 0 0 0 0;}
@font-face
        {font-family:"DejaVu Sans";
        panose-1:2 11 6 3 3 8 4 2 2 4;}
@font-face
        {font-family:"Century Gothic";
        panose-1:2 11 5 2 2 2 2 2 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
</head>
<body text="#000000" bgcolor="#ffffff">
-------- Original Message --------
<table class="moz-email-headers-table" border="0" cellpadding="0"
cellspacing="0">
<tbody>
<tr>
<th nowrap="nowrap" valign="BASELINE" align="RIGHT">Subject: </th>
<td>Tender for an Agriculture Inventory & Landuse Mapping
Plugin</td>
</tr>
<tr>
<th nowrap="nowrap" valign="BASELINE" align="RIGHT">Date: </th>
<td>Wed, 5 Jan 2011 03:16:35 +0100</td>
</tr>
<tr>
<th nowrap="nowrap" valign="BASELINE" align="RIGHT">From: </th>
<td>Aravena, Ricardo GIZ LA <a class="moz-txt-link-rfc2396E" href="mailto:ricardo.aravena@giz.de"><ricardo.aravena@giz.de></a></td>
</tr>
<tr>
<th nowrap="nowrap" valign="BASELINE" align="RIGHT">To: </th>
<td><a class="moz-txt-link-abbreviated" href="mailto:qgis-developer@lists.osgeo.org">qgis-developer@lists.osgeo.org</a>
<a class="moz-txt-link-rfc2396E" href="mailto:qgis-developer@lists.osgeo.org"><qgis-developer@lists.osgeo.org></a></td>
</tr>
<tr>
<th nowrap="nowrap" valign="BASELINE" align="RIGHT">CC: </th>
<td><br>
</td>
</tr>
</tbody>
</table>
<br>
<meta http-equiv="Content-Type" content="text/html;
charset=ISO-8859-1">
<meta name="Generator" content="Microsoft Word 12 (filtered medium)">
<style><!--
/* Font Definitions */
@font-face
        {font-family:"Cambria Math";
        panose-1:2 4 5 3 5 4 6 3 2 4;}
@font-face
        {font-family:Calibri;
        panose-1:2 15 5 2 2 2 4 3 2 4;}
@font-face
        {font-family:Candara;
        panose-1:2 14 5 2 3 3 3 2 2 4;}
@font-face
        {font-family:GTZ-Logo;
        panose-1:0 0 0 0 0 0 0 0 0 0;}
@font-face
        {font-family:"DejaVu Sans";
        panose-1:2 11 6 3 3 8 4 2 2 4;}
@font-face
        {font-family:"Century Gothic";
        panose-1:2 11 5 2 2 2 2 2 2 4;}
/* Style Definitions */
p.MsoNormal, li.MsoNormal, div.MsoNormal
        {margin:0in;
        margin-bottom:.0001pt;
        font-size:11.0pt;
        font-family:"Calibri","sans-serif";}
a:link, span.MsoHyperlink
        {mso-style-priority:99;
        color:blue;
        text-decoration:underline;}
a:visited, span.MsoHyperlinkFollowed
        {mso-style-priority:99;
        color:purple;
        text-decoration:underline;}
span.EmailStyle17
        {mso-style-type:personal-compose;
        font-family:"Calibri","sans-serif";
        color:windowtext;}
.MsoChpDefault
        {mso-style-type:export-only;}
@page WordSection1
        {size:8.5in 11.0in;
        margin:1.0in 1.0in 1.0in 1.0in;}
div.WordSection1
        {page:WordSection1;}
--></style><!--[if gte mso 9]><xml>
<o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
<o:shapelayout v:ext="edit">
<o:idmap v:ext="edit" data="1" />
</o:shapelayout></xml><![endif]-->
<div class="WordSection1">
<p class="MsoNormal">Dear developers,<br>
<br>
Please find below a detailed Request for a Proposal and
Quotation for an AILUM (Agriculture Inventory and Land Use
Mapping) plug-in for QGIS.<br>
The tender is being announced by GTZ (German Technical
Cooperation).<br>
Note that the deadline for submission is the 04-Feb-2011, and
the award date is 15-Feb-2011.
<br>
Please feel free to contact Ricardo Aravena (<a
moz-do-not-send="true" href="mailto:ricardo.aravena@gtz.de">ricardo.aravena@gtz.de</a>)
if you have any questions regards the technical specification
and the tendering/bidding process.<br>
<br>
<b>Organizational Overview </b><br>
The Deutsche Gesellschaft für Technische Zusammenarbeit (German
Society for Technical Cooperation) or GTZ is a private
international enterprise owned by the German Federal Government,
specializing in technical cooperation for sustainable
development with worldwide operation. It primarily works for
public sector organizations and is headquartered in Eschborn,
Germany. It mainly operates on behalf of the Federal Ministry
for Economic Cooperation and Development (BMZ). Further clients
are other departments of the government, international donors
like the European Union, World Bank or the United Nations,
partner countries and the private sector. GTZ works on a
public-benefit basis. All surpluses generated are channeled back
into its own international cooperation projects for sustainable
development. The GTZ provides services in the following areas of
sustainable development: Economic Development and Employment;
Government, Democracy and Poverty Reduction; Education, Health
and Social Security; Environment and Infrastructure &
Agriculture, Fisheries and Food.<br>
<br>
<b>Required Deliverables</b><br>
A QGIS plugin for an automated process to manually classify land
types from satellite imagery for land use mapping based on
visual identification.<br>
<br>
<b>Function</b><br>
To avoid high-level academic training of remote sensing
classification techniques, an easy, yet robust method of
classifying land types simply by clicking on them from visual
identification as a non-expert would from a common application
like GIMP is required. The idea is that non-experts would be
able to conduct their own land use mapping. The areas from the
resultant vector land use maps produced would be further applied
to calculate indicators such as expected crop yield.<br>
<br>
<b>Target Users </b><br>
The tool is principally intended for an agricultural inventory
project to be conducted by provincial staff from the northern
Laotian province of Luang Namtha, though it would also be useful
for some Participatory Land Use Planning and other mapping
activities across other provinces in Laos. Thus it needs to be
as simple and automated as possible.<br>
As it is intended to be an Open Source tool under GNU (general
public use) license, it could also potentially be used by anyone
with an internet connection and QGIS. It would serve well in the
development context where funding, expert knowledge and training
is limited. <br>
<br>
<b>Technical Specification</b><br>
A Python plugin is to be coded for QGIS as either a new Menu
tool set, Panel or Toolbar.
<br>
The plugin will have 3 parts:<br>
1. Imagery preparation – this will automate 4 steps: <br>
(i) conversion of images to 8 bit Geotif (if necessary), <br>
(ii) creation of a georeferencing tag file (.gtf), <br>
(iii) Equalization, <br>
(iv) then Blur. <br>
The user will simply be asked where to store the new files for
the image and then the steps will be run in sequence
automatically.
<br>
2. Classification – <br>
a) Visual classifications of distinct, contiguous recognizable
land types are to be conducted on the standard QGIS map
interface the same way it would be done in a program like GIMP
with BOTH the ‘Fuzzy Select Tool’ and the ‘Select by Color
Tool’. The users will apply these tools on a trial-and-error
basis with similar dynamic ‘Threshold’ slide bars as in GIMP’s
interface until they are satisfied with their selections.
<br>
b) A third tool would also be necessary to group or generalize
the user’s selections, the way ‘Select>Border’ would do in
GIMP.<br>
c) A dialog should appear on request every time the user is
satisfied with their selection to render the land types with an
appropriate colour and assign a textual label which will be
included in a landuse field. The colours and texts should be
editable and not limited in number. This label and colour
information may somehow be embedded in the image or stored
separately in a look up table if necessary so that it can be
rendered accordingly in the resulting end-product vector
shapefile.<br>
3. Vectorization – this will polygonize the classified image as
contiguously as possible to a shapefile. And the landuse and a
colour fields generated in the precious step will need to be
either maintained or associated correspondingly to the
shapefile.<br>
<br>
It is proposed that:<br>
- The conversion of the imagery to 8 bit Geotif and the creation
of a tag file could be done with GDAL commands.<br>
- The Equalization and Blur need to be produced with the same
effect and quality as that produced by GIMP’s
Colors>Auto>Equalize and Filters>Blur>Gaussian Blur
respectively; however since GIMP’s libraries can only be run
internally from within GIMP, it is proposed to implement the
equivalent functionality from ImageMagick’s libraries instead.<br>
- The same goes for the ‘Fuzzy Select Tool’, ‘Select by Color
Tool’ and ‘Select>Border’ GIMP equivalents.<br>
- The vectorization could be conducted by the GDAL polygonize
function for example as long as its parameters can be set to
produce contiguity to reduce individual pixelization.<br>
- Step 2b), the most challenging, could be catered for in many
ways and so will be left up to the solution provider’s
discretion. Use of the already translated Orfeo Toolbox
libraries is encouraged.<br>
<br>
This is the proposed construction and presentation for the
plugin, however if applicants present a better workflow or
methodology this will also certainly be considered and in fact
favored.
<br>
<br>
<b>Assumptions & Agreements </b><br>
- The name of the plugin shall be “AILUM (Agriculture Inventory
and Land Use Mapping)”.<br>
- The plugin needs to be a completely Open Source solution with
no legal infringements.<br>
- After being tested, the plugin and its code will be publicly
available under GNU license as FLOSS.<br>
<br>
<b>Technical Proposal </b><br>
The solution provider should include time-lines and schedules
for completing the project.
<br>
<br>
<b>Time-Cost </b><br>
The solution provider must detail the time and costs that will
be required to complete the project.
<br>
<br>
<b>Additional Documentation</b><br>
Developers can direct us to an internet site or repository which
demonstrates their production capabilities.
<br>
<br>
<b>References </b><br>
References are optional, though preferable if the candidate is
not a company with a published track record.<br>
<br>
<b>Submission Deadline </b><br>
4, February, 2011.<br>
<br>
<b>Submit Proposal To: </b><br>
Ricardo Aravena<br>
Email: <a moz-do-not-send="true"
href="mailto:ricardo.aravena@gtz.de">ricardo.aravena@gtz.de</a><br>
<br>
<b>For additional information or clarification, contact: </b><br>
Ricardo Aravena<br>
Email: <a moz-do-not-send="true"
href="mailto:ricardo.aravena@gtz.de">ricardo.aravena@gtz.de</a><br>
<br>
<b>Basis for Award of Contract </b><br>
Balance between the best functional solution and the lowest bid.<br>
<br>
<b>Award Date </b><br>
15, February, 2011.<o:p></o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><span style="font-size: 14pt; font-family:
"Candara","sans-serif"; color: rgb(31, 73,
125);">Ricardo Aravena<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 9p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">Deutsche Gesellschaft für Technische Zusammenarbeit</span><span
style="color: rgb(200, 15, 15);">
</span><span style="font-size: 24pt; font-family:
"GTZ-Logo","serif"; color: rgb(200, 15,
15);">gtz</span><span style="font-size: 7.5p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">
</span><span style="font-size: 9p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">GmbH</span><b><span style="font-size: 14pt; color:
rgb(200, 15, 15);"><o:p></o:p></span></b></p>
<p class="MsoNormal"><b><i><span style="color: rgb(31, 73, 125);">GIS
Advisor<o:p></o:p></span></i></b></p>
<p class="MsoNormal"><b><i><span style="color: rgb(31, 73, 125);">Lao-German
Cooperation<o:p></o:p></span></i></b></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);">GTZ- Office Vientiane / Laos</span><span
style="font-size: 10pt; font-family: "DejaVu
Sans","sans-serif"; color: rgb(31, 73, 125);"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);">T: ++85621-353605</span><span style="font-size:
10pt; color: rgb(31, 73, 125);"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);" lang="DE">F: ++85621-312408</span><span
style="font-size: 10pt; font-family: "Century
Gothic","sans-serif"; color: rgb(31, 73, 125);"
lang="DE"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);" lang="DE">M: ++85620-3355096</span><span
style="font-size: 12pt; color: rgb(31, 73, 125);" lang="DE"><o:p></o:p></span></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><o:p> </o:p></p>
<p class="MsoNormal"><span style="font-size: 14pt; font-family:
"Candara","sans-serif"; color: rgb(31, 73,
125);">Ricardo Aravena<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 9p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">Deutsche Gesellschaft für Technische Zusammenarbeit</span><span
style="color: rgb(200, 15, 15);">
</span><span style="font-size: 24pt; font-family:
"GTZ-Logo","serif"; color: rgb(200, 15,
15);">gtz</span><span style="font-size: 7.5p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">
</span><span style="font-size: 9pt; font-family:
"Arial","sans-serif"; color: rgb(200, 15,
15);">GmbH</span><b><span style="font-size: 14pt; color:
rgb(200, 15, 15);"><o:p></o:p></span></b></p>
<p class="MsoNormal"><b><i><span style="color: rgb(31, 73, 125);">GIS
Advisor<o:p></o:p></span></i></b></p>
<p class="MsoNormal"><b><i><span style="color: rgb(31, 73, 125);">Lao-German
Cooperation<o:p></o:p></span></i></b></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);">GTZ- Office Vientiane / Laos</span><span
style="font-size: 10pt; font-family: "DejaVu
Sans","sans-serif"; color: rgb(31, 73, 125);"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);">T: ++85621-353605<o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);" lang="DE">F: ++85621-312408</span><span
style="font-size: 10pt; font-family: "Century
Gothic","sans-serif"; color: rgb(31, 73, 125);"
lang="DE"><o:p></o:p></span></p>
<p class="MsoNormal"><span style="font-size: 10pt; color: rgb(31,
73, 125);" lang="DE">M: ++85620-3355096</span><span
style="font-size: 12pt; color: rgb(31, 73, 125);" lang="DE"><o:p></o:p></span></p>
<p class="MsoNormal"><o:p> </o:p></p>
</div>
<br>
<hr>
<font color="Black" face="Arial" size="1">Deutsche Gesellschaft fuer
Internationale Zusammenarbeit (GIZ) GmbH;<br>
Sitz der Gesellschaft Bonn und Eschborn/Registered Office Bonn and
Eschborn; Germany;<br>
Registergericht/Registered at Amtsgericht Frankfurt am Main,
Germany; Eintragungs-Nr./Registration no. HRB 12394;<br>
USt-IdNr./VAT ID no. DE 113891176;<br>
Vorsitzender des Aufsichtsrates/Chairman of the Supervisory Board:
Hans-Juergen Beerfeltz, Staatssekretaer/State Secretary;<br>
Vorstandssprecher/Chairman of the Management Board: Dr. Bernd
Eisenblaetter; Vorstand/Management Board: Dr. Christoph Beier,
Adolf Kloke-Lesch, Tom Paetz, Dr. Sebastian Paust, Dr.
Hans-Joachim Preuss, Dr. Juergen Wilhelm<br>
</font>
<br>
</body>
</html>